Museum Curation of San Juan River Fish Samples
ArchivedBureau of Reclamation - Upper Colorado Region
Description
The University of New Mexico’s Museum of Southwest Biology is the repository of record for fish samples collected in the San Juan River as well as throughout New Mexico. It is designated as the state of New Mexico’s official museum for plants, animals, fish, amphibians and insects. Furthermore, this museum has been collecting and curating the samples for the San Juan River Recovery Program for the last 15 years and maintenance of this collection is required under the Program’s Long Range Plan.
